Bitget App
Trade smarter
Acquista CryptoMercatiTradingFuturesCopy TradingBotEarn
Blockchain
Comprendere i layer della blockchain

Comprendere i layer della blockchain

Nuovo utente
2024-01-18 | 5m

In breve, i layer di una blockchain mirano a velocizzare notevolmente le transazioni e a ridurre i costi. In questo articolo non ci addentreremo nella complessa matematica alla loro base, concentrandoci sullo spiegare concetti come il protocollo a conoscenza zero e i rollup, mostrando come questi ottimizzino i tassi di transazione e riducano i costi.

Una spiegazione sui layer della blockchain

Quando si parla di blockchain, spesso salta fuori anche il termine "layer 1". Potrebbe sembrare complicato, ma è piuttosto semplice: essenzialmente, si tratta di una blockchain indipendente. Ethereum e Bitcoin sono i due esempi più noti.

Immagina la tecnologia blockchain come una torta a strati, con ogni strato collocato su quello precedente. Il livello fondamentale, o layer 0, non è una blockchain vera e propria, ma consiste in protocolli di rete, protocolli Internet e altri elementi fondamentali come i miner e i nodi.

Le blockchain di layer 1, come Ethereum e Bitcoin, sono indipendenti e non dipendono da nessun'altra blockchain. Al contrario, le blockchain di layer 2, come Arbitrum o StarkNet, dipendono dalle loro blockchain madri per funzionare.

A causa della loro rapida adozione, è urgente migliorare la scalabilità della blockchain Ethereum per gestire l'aumento dei costi e della congestione. Per affrontare queste sfide, gli sviluppatori stanno esplorando le reti di layer 3, progettate per funzioni specifiche. Attualmente Avalanche e StarkWare sono in prima linea nello sviluppo di soluzioni di layer 3.

Cosa sono i rollup?

I rollup sono un tipo di soluzione di scalabilità di Layer 2 per blockchain come Ethereum. Funzionano "impacchettando" (da qui il termine rollup) più transazioni insieme ed eseguendo tutti i calcoli altrove, riducendo il numero di transazioni elaborate sulla blockchain principale, che considera uno di questi pacchetti di transazioni come una singola transazione. Questo aumenta drasticamente la capacità effettiva della rete (attualmente circa 15 transazioni al secondo per la Mainnet di Ethereum) e riduce le commissioni sul gas a una frazione di quelle originali.

Per come è stato progettato, Ethereum non offre intrinsecamente la privacy, ed è per questo che vengono sviluppate soluzioni aggiuntive, o rollup, per fornire una maggiore privacy. Essenzialmente i rollup, optimistic rollup e zk-rollup compresi, sono estensioni di Ethereum, ideati per aumentare le sue capacità e non per competere con esso.

Considera Ethereum come un immobile di prima scelta, localizzati in posti come Champs-Elysées di Parigi o Times Square di New York, dove ha senso esporre i prodotti, ma non produrli a causa dei costi elevati. Allo stesso modo, le soluzioni di layer 2 e i rollup utilizzano gli "immobili di prima scelta" di Ethereum per mostrare le prove di integrità del sistema, mentre l'elaborazione delle transazioni è relegata in luoghi meno "costosi".

Che cos'è un zk-proof?

Gli zk-rollup , abbreviazione di zero-knowledge rollup, sono soluzioni di rollup che sfruttano il protocollo a conoscenza zero per “impacchettare” le transazioni ed eseguire tutti i calcoli off-chain. Gli zk-rollup hanno fatto grandi progressi sia in termini di sicurezza che di flessibilità. La validità di tutte le transazioni può essere dimostrata senza rivelare alcuna informazione al riguardo, garantendo a tutti i partecipanti privacy e sicurezza. Poiché tutti i calcoli vengono eseguiti fuori dalla blockchain, gli zk-rollup possono anche supportare smart contract complessi e altre funzionalità avanzate per i quali è necessario eseguire dei calcoli. Questo li rende ideali per gli exchange decentralizzati e altre applicazioni DeFi. Attualmente, tra i principali nomi del settore degli zk-rollup figurano Polygon, Loopring e ZkSync.

Conclusione

In sintesi, i layer della blockchain, compresi i layer 1 come Ethereum e Bitcoin e i layer 2 come Arbitrum, sono fondamentali per ottimizzare la velocità delle transazioni e ridurre i costi nelle reti blockchain. I protocolli a conoscenza zero assicurano l'integrità delle transazioni senza comprometterne i dettagli, e i rollup, in quanto estensioni di Ethereum, offrono maggiore privacy e scalabilità.

Crea un account e inizia a esplorare l’incredibile universo di Bitget!

Tutti i prodotti e i progetti descritti in questo articolo non costituiscono una raccomandazione e sono forniti solo a scopo informativo. Il suo contenuto è esclusivamente didattico e non è da intendersi come consulenza sugli investimenti. Prima di prendere decisioni di carattere finanziario è opportuno consultare professionisti qualificati.

Condividi
link_icon